The Cowboys and Golden Hurricane enter their Week 2 game on shakier footing than initially anticipated.

Oklahoma State struggled to a 23-16 victory against FCS Missouri State last week, and Tulsa fell to FCS UC-Davis 19-17. Each school will look to get back on track Saturday in Stillwater. Here are some stats and info to get you ready for the contest.

Series History

The Cowboys are 42-27-5 all-time against the Golden Hurricane with OSU winning the teams’ past eight games. Tulsa hasn’t won in Stillwater since 1951, suffering 22 straight away losses entering Saturday’s game. Here are how the teams’ past 10 meetings have shook out.

Season Winner Score Location
2020 Oklahoma State 16-7 Stillwater
2019 Oklahoma State 40-21 Tulsa
2017 Oklahoma State 59-24 Stillwater
2011 Oklahoma State 59-33 Tulsa
2010 Oklahoma State 65-28 Stillwater
2004 Oklahoma State 38-21 Stillwater
2000 Oklahoma State 36-26 Tulsa
1999 Oklahoma State 46-9 Stillwater
1998 Tulsa 35-20 Tulsa
1996 Oklahoma State 30-9 Stillwater
